Client-centered Therapy
A form of psychotherapy developed by Carl Rogers that emphasizes an empathetic, accepting, and genuine environment for clients to facilitate personal growth.
Nonjudgmental Setting
A supportive environment where individuals feel safe to express themselves without fear of criticism or judgment.
Rational-emotive Behavior Therapy
A form of psychotherapy that helps individuals identify self-defeating thoughts and feelings, challenge the rationality of those feelings, and replace them with healthier, more productive beliefs.
Albert Ellis
An American psychologist known for developing Rational Emotive Behavior Therapy (REBT), a form of psychotherapy aimed at resolving emotional and behavioral problems.
